I picked up an e-bike today for a month's hire totally free of charge. Cycling UK have a #MakingCyclingEasier scheme in #Manchester (and #Sheffield, #Leicester and #Luton), free hire for a month, including a lock, a helmet, charger etc.

First impressions are I love it! Definitely going to get me #cycling further.

I'm going to log my progress here, keep up with which journeys I do, and see what impact, if any, the e-bike has on my car use.

For context, we're a one car family of two adults and two toddlers. I commute via train. Usual car use is nursery drop-offs, supermarket shops etc. Occasionally to rehearsals or gigs. The loan e-bike doesn't have any pannier racks or similar for transporting things.

I also don't cycle much. Once or twice a week, weather dependent.

Day 7 #ElectricBikeMonth

Success!! I commuted!! On the e-bike 8.4 miles to work. Felt largely safe, enjoyed the #OxfordRoad cycle lanes, dodged a few pedestrians in Rusholme, got chatting to another dad about his #RadWagon cargo bike (jealous). Only really using top 3-4 gears (out of 9).

And then.

About 5 mins from home... the chain came off uphill. And got wedged in pretty tight next to the gear. No allen keys with me. Unable to fix. 20 min dejected walk home.
